The Witcher 3’s Upcoming Switch Patch Will Be “Worth the Wait”

The Witcher 3 port devs Saber Interactive might have something interesting planned for the game's next patch.

The Witcher 3’s seen a resurgence in activity nearly five years after its launch over the past few months, thanks in large part to the Netflix series, which has resulted in CDPR’s 2015 open world title breaking its player count records on Steam, and also seeing renewed popularity on the PS4 sales charts.

Before all that though, the game also came out for the Nintendo Switch, impossibly enough, with the port being handled by Saber Interactive. The studio said not too long ago that it was working on a new patch for the game, and while you might be forgiven for thinking that it probably won’t be anything major, it seems like it might have more in store than we thought. Recently, posting on its official VK social media page, Saber Interactive said that the upcoming update will be “worth the wait”- which is an interesting thing to say for a patch of a port of an older game.
